    ABOUT ROB WILLIAMSONRob was born and raised in California.He attended Princeton University, University College London and Harvard Law School.After graduating from law school, Rob returned to California and joined Mitchell, Silberberg and Knupp, an entertainment law firm in Century City.He then joined the Western Center on Law and Poverty, and from there became the Director of Clinical Studies at Southwestern University School of Law, where he was a fully tenured professor teaching lawyering skills, family law and community property.

    Rob moved to Seattle in 1979 and initially worked for the Legal Services Corporation as the Regional Training Coordinator, and then for Evergreen Legal Services as a senior litigator.Rob has been in private practice since 1981.He has brought class actions on behalf of consumers and employees, won the largest verdict in the nation for migrant farm workers' damages for wrongful termination, and represents injured persons, especially men and women injured in the maritime industry or who work for railroads.
